Welcome to Eterna

Deep in the high mountains, in a secluded forest was a thriving kingdom. This kingdom was enclosed in an ordinate circular stone wall with a high gate to ensure the safety of all its citizens.  Said kingdom was rumored to be the most prosperous kingdom of all the land. People far and wide flock towards the kingdom in hopes to share in its abundant wealth. It was known for its bustling marketplace, world renowned blacksmiths, and hearty crops. This kingdom was named Eterna in hopes that the kingdom would retain its prosperity for all of ETERNITY.

Eterna was also a very magical place. Unknown to a majority of the citizens of Eterna’s great prosperity was attributed to a certain tree in the center of the town square. This tree, despite being well over the several hundred years old does not bear any fruit or do the leaves ever wilt. It does on the other hand, purify and enchant the water that the villagers use to water the crops which results in hearty crops for export. It gives life to the land, thus it was called the Tree of Life. 

Sadly, to a majority of the citizens this tree is a waste of space and the only reason why it wasn’t cut down and used for kindling was that this tree was the princess’s favorite tree. She loved this tree so much; she decreed that no one is to harm the sacred tree.  This tree is indeed the reason for her kingdom’s success, but the reason why she loved the tree so much was that when she was a little girl the tree granted her wish.

As princess it was extremely hard to make friends considering how everyone treated you differently. So one day she decided to make a wish. The tree hearing the princess’s plea brought the four girls together and thus began their blossoming friendship. Those four girls were chosen to become the Tree of Life’s guardians.

The tree bestowed each girl a gift to use when necessary. Unfortunately the tree never mentioned when it was necessary to use it, thus they decided to improvise. The princess was given a pendant to ward away evil. It would later be known the princess’s signature accessory. The young orphan girl was given a sword. That sword would later belong to the strongest sword master of the land. Everyone would know her as “The Lady-Knight”.  The apothecary’s daughter was given a walking stick. She would later be known as the “Village Doctor”. The blind child was given the gift of foresight. Being clairvoyant, she was able to often predict when her friends needed help. She later became a nun at the church of Eterna.

And thus our story begins…
